Nearly 800 Malicious npm Packages Deliver Cross-Platform RAT and Infostealer

Aug 7, 2026, 06:48 PM · by The Hacker News

A cluster of nearly 800 malicious packages has been published to the npm registry as part of a new campaign designed to deliver cross-platform malware targeting Windows, Mac, and Linux systems.
